What These Numbers Mean for Miami Beach Buyers and Sellers
Miami Beach currently registers as a Buyer's Market market, and the combination of indicators in the Housing Market Trends module above points clearly toward where negotiating leverage sits. With 9.2 months of supply and 1,574 active listings against 172 homes sold in the latest month, buyers are operating in an environment with meaningful choice. Only 4.1% of homes sold above their asking price, while 16.6% of listings recorded a price reduction, a signal that many sellers are entering at prices the market has not yet met.
The average sale-to-list ratio of 93.71% confirms that most closings settle below the original ask, and a median of 155 days on market gives buyers time to analyze comparables rather than react. Just 11.3% of homes leave the market within two weeks, so the pressure to submit an instant offer is low. For a buyer, this favors offering below list, requesting concessions, and prioritizing homes that have already logged a price drop. For a seller, the same data argues for disciplined pricing from day one, since the median sale price sits at $720,000 and overpricing tends to extend time on market and invite the reductions that 16.6% of listings have absorbed.
At a median of $667.289 per square foot, pricing precision matters more than ever. With 4,440 licensed agents working the area, outcomes vary widely by representation, which is why identifying agents with verified track records in these specific conditions is worth the effort before listing or making an offer.

What does the median sale price in Miami Beach mean for sellers?
Miami Beach's median sale price is $720,000 as of May 2026. Half of recent sales closed above that figure and half below. It is a useful baseline for understanding the market, but an experienced local agent will price your home against comparable recent sales in your neighborhood, not the citywide median.
How long does it take to sell a house in Miami Beach?
The median home in Miami Beach currently takes 155 days to sell, and that timeline has seen a +37 days change year over year, reflecting a market with 9.2 months of supply. Your actual timeline depends on pricing accuracy, property condition, location, and price point. With 16.6% of listings recording reductions, homes priced to current comparables from day one tend to sell faster, while overpriced listings often sit and eventually cut, extending the process well beyond the median.

What commission do Miami Beach realtors charge?
Commissions are negotiable and vary by agent, service level, and transaction. There is no set rate, and recent industry changes have made commission structures more flexible than ever. Discuss the structure directly with your agent before signing a listing or buyer agreement.
Should I use a local Miami Beach agent or a national brand?
The individual agent matters more than the brand on the sign. Offices within the same national franchise vary widely in performance, and the agent you hire, not the logo, prices your home, negotiates your contract, and manages your closing. A strong local agent brings firsthand knowledge of Miami Beach neighborhoods, pricing patterns, and buyer activity. Compare agents on verified local results such as recent sales, days on market, and negotiation outcomes rather than name recognition.
What questions should I ask a Miami Beach realtor before hiring them?
Ask how many homes they have closed in Miami Beach in the past year, what their average sale-to-list ratio is, and how much of their business is in your neighborhood and price range. Ask how they will market your home or find you listings, and how often they will communicate. Strong agents answer with specifics. Verified transaction data is the fastest way to confirm what you hear.
